A bowl of Crockpot Pasta Fagioli with ground beef, beans, and pasta in a rich tomato broth, garnished with Parmesan and fresh parsley.

Introduction

There’s nothing quite like a warm, hearty bowl of Pasta Fagioli to bring comfort on a chilly evening. This slow-cooked Italian classic is a rich blend of ground beef, tender beans, fresh vegetables, and perfectly cooked pasta, all simmered in a flavorful tomato-based broth. It’s the kind of meal that feels like a warm hug, satisfying and nourishing in every bite.

If you love a recipe that’s both easy and packed with flavor, this Crockpot Pasta Fagioli is for you. The best part? It requires minimal effort. Simply brown the beef, toss everything into the slow cooker, and let the magic happen. By the time dinner rolls around, you’ll have a savory, slow-simmered soup that tastes like it’s been cooking all day – because it has.

Whether you’re making this for a cozy family dinner, meal prepping for the week, or hosting friends for a casual get-together, this dish is a crowd-pleaser. It’s budget-friendly, freezer-friendly, and even better the next day.

Let’s dive into what makes this recipe a must-try and how you can make it perfect every time.

Why You’ll Love This Recipe

Key Benefits

  • Effortless Cooking – The slow cooker does all the heavy lifting, leaving you free to go about your day.
  • Rich, Hearty Flavor – A well-balanced combination of beef, beans, tomatoes, and herbs creates a deep, satisfying taste.
  • Nutritious & Filling – Packed with protein, fiber, and vitamins, this soup is as healthy as it is comforting.
  • Perfect for Meal Prep – Make a big batch and enjoy it throughout the week. It reheats beautifully.
  • Great for All Seasons – While it’s a classic cold-weather dish, it’s light enough to enjoy year-round.

Who Is This Recipe For?

  • Busy Home Cooks – If you love homemade meals but don’t have time to cook every night, this is perfect.
  • Soup Lovers – If you enjoy hearty, Italian-style soups, this one’s a must-try.
  • Families – It’s kid-friendly, satisfying, and pairs perfectly with crusty bread.
  • Anyone Who Loves Italian Comfort Food – Pasta, beans, and a rich tomato broth? It doesn’t get better than that.

Ingredients for Crockpot Pasta Fagioli

A bowl of Crockpot Pasta Fagioli with ground beef, beans, and pasta in a rich tomato broth, garnished with Parmesan and fresh parsley.

Core Ingredients

Each ingredient in this recipe plays an important role in building flavor and texture. Here’s what you’ll need:

  • Ground beef – Adds a savory, meaty base. You can also use ground turkey or Italian sausage for a different twist.
  • Onion, garlic, carrots, and celery – These aromatics provide depth and sweetness to the broth.
  • Diced tomatoes & tomato sauce – A combination of both gives the soup its signature rich, tomatoey flavor.
  • Red kidney beans & great northern beans – They add protein, fiber, and a creamy texture.
  • Beef broth – Enhances the savory, umami depth of the soup.
  • Italian seasoning, salt, black pepper, oregano, and basil – This classic blend of herbs brings an authentic Italian taste.
  • Ditalini pasta – The small pasta shape is traditional for Pasta Fagioli and soaks up the flavors beautifully.
  • Grated Parmesan cheese & fresh parsley – The finishing touches that add extra flavor and freshness.

Substitutions and Tips

Want to tweak the recipe to suit your needs? Here are some easy swaps:

  • For a leaner option: Use ground turkey instead of beef.
  • For a vegetarian version: Skip the meat and use vegetable broth instead of beef broth.
  • For a thicker soup: Mash some of the beans before adding them to the crockpot.
  • For a gluten-free version: Use gluten-free pasta or substitute it with rice.
  • For an extra kick: Add red pepper flakes or a dash of hot sauce.

This recipe is forgiving, so feel free to make it your own. The key is balancing the flavors and letting the slow cooker work its magic.

How to Make Crockpot Pasta Fagioli

Now that we’ve covered why this recipe is a must-try and gone over the ingredients, it’s time to get cooking. One of the best things about this dish is how easy it is to make. With just a little prep, you’ll have a warm, hearty soup that tastes like it came straight from an Italian kitchen.

Let’s break it down step by step.

Kitchen Tools You’ll Need

Before we start, here are the tools that will make the process smooth and hassle-free.

Must-Have Tools

  • Crockpot (Slow Cooker): The heart of this recipe. A 6-quart or larger slow cooker works best.
  • Skillet: For browning the beef before adding it to the crockpot.
  • Wooden Spoon: Perfect for stirring everything together.
  • Knife & Cutting Board: Essential for chopping vegetables.

Nice-to-Have Tools

  • Garlic Press: Speeds up mincing garlic.
  • Ladle: Makes serving easier.
  • Cheese Grater: Freshly grated Parmesan takes this dish to the next level.

Step-by-Step Instructions

A bowl of Crockpot Pasta Fagioli with ground beef, beans, and pasta in a rich tomato broth, garnished with Parmesan and fresh parsley.

Step 1: Brown the Beef

First, we need to cook the ground beef to bring out its rich, savory flavor.

  • Heat a large skillet over medium heat.
  • Add the ground beef, breaking it apart with a spoon as it cooks.
  • Stir occasionally and cook until the beef is fully browned, about 5-7 minutes.
  • Drain any excess fat to avoid a greasy soup.
  • Transfer the beef to the crockpot.

Pro Tip: If you’re using Italian sausage instead of beef, remove the casing and cook it the same way for extra flavor.

Step 2: Add Vegetables & Seasoning

Now, it’s time to layer in the vegetables and seasonings. These ingredients will simmer together, creating a deep, rich broth.

  • Add the diced onion, garlic, carrots, and celery to the crockpot.
  • Pour in the diced tomatoes and tomato sauce.
  • Add the drained kidney beans and great northern beans.
  • Pour in beef broth until everything is well covered.
  • Sprinkle in the Italian seasoning, salt, black pepper, oregano, and basil.

Give everything a good stir to combine. At this point, it already smells amazing, but just wait until it slow-cooks.

Step 3: Slow Cook the Soup

The best part about this recipe is that once everything is in the crockpot, you can step away and let it do its thing.

  • Cover the crockpot with the lid.
  • Cook on low for 6-8 hours or high for 3-4 hours, until the vegetables are tender and the flavors have blended beautifully.

This long, slow simmer is what makes the broth so rich and flavorful. The vegetables soften, the beans absorb the delicious seasonings, and the beef becomes even more tender.

Pro Tip: If you’re home while it’s cooking, give it a stir every couple of hours to help the flavors meld even more.

Step 4: Cook the Pasta

Pasta is the final touch that brings everything together, but there’s a trick to getting it just right.

  • About 30 minutes before serving, stir in the ditalini pasta.
  • Cover and continue cooking until the pasta is tender but not mushy.

Adding the pasta too early can result in overcooked, mushy noodles, so it’s important to wait until the end.

Want to make this soup ahead of time? If you’re planning to store or freeze leftovers, consider cooking the pasta separately and adding it to each bowl when serving. This keeps the texture perfect even after reheating.

Step 5: Serve & Garnish

Now comes the best part—serving up a warm bowl of Pasta Fagioli.

  • Ladle the soup into bowls.
  • Sprinkle with freshly grated Parmesan cheese.
  • Garnish with chopped fresh parsley for a burst of color and flavor.
  • Serve with crusty bread or a side salad for a complete meal.

This soup is hearty and filling on its own, but a slice of toasted garlic bread on the side makes it even better.

Tips for Success

Making great Pasta Fagioli is all about balance—balancing flavors, textures, and cooking times. Here are some expert tips to ensure your soup turns out perfect every time.

Don’t Overcook the Pasta

Pasta soaks up liquid as it sits, so if you’re planning to store leftovers, consider cooking it separately and adding it to individual servings. This keeps it from becoming too soft.

Adjust the Seasoning to Taste

This soup is all about big, bold flavors. Before serving, taste and adjust the seasoning. Sometimes, a little extra salt or a pinch of red pepper flakes can take it to the next level.

Use Fresh Herbs for Garnish

While dried herbs bring great depth of flavor during cooking, finishing with fresh parsley or basil adds brightness that makes the dish feel fresh and vibrant.

Make It Spicy

If you like a little heat, add red pepper flakes while the soup is cooking, or serve with a dash of hot sauce.

Thicken the Soup (If Needed)

If you prefer a thicker broth, try mashing some of the beans before adding them to the crockpot. This releases their natural starches, giving the soup a heartier texture.

With these simple steps and expert tips, you’re on your way to making the best Crockpot Pasta Fagioli. In the next section, we’ll cover how to store leftovers, common questions, and variations to make this recipe your own.

How to Store Crockpot Pasta Fagioli

A bowl of Crockpot Pasta Fagioli with ground beef, beans, and pasta in a rich tomato broth, garnished with Parmesan and fresh parsley.

One of the best things about this soup is how well it keeps. The flavors continue to develop, making leftovers just as delicious—if not better—the next day.

At Room Temperature

  • Like any cooked dish, Pasta Fagioli shouldn’t sit out for more than two hours at room temperature.
  • After that, transfer it to an airtight container and refrigerate to keep it fresh.

In the Refrigerator

  • Store in an airtight container for up to 4 days.
  • The pasta will continue to soak up the broth, so you may need to add a splash of water or broth when reheating.

In the Freezer

  • This soup freezes beautifully, but there’s one trick: freeze it without the pasta.
  • Cook the pasta separately and add it fresh when serving for the best texture.
  • Store in freezer-safe containers for up to 3 months.
  • Thaw overnight in the fridge before reheating.

How to Reheat Pasta Fagioli

On the Stovetop

  • Pour the soup into a pot over medium heat.
  • Add a little broth or water if it has thickened too much.
  • Stir occasionally until heated through.

In the Microwave

  • Place in a microwave-safe bowl.
  • Cover and heat in 1-minute intervals, stirring between each one.
  • Add broth if needed to loosen the texture.

If the pasta has absorbed too much liquid, try adding a fresh batch of cooked pasta before serving.

Frequently Asked Questions (FAQs)

Can I make this recipe vegetarian?

Absolutely. Just leave out the ground beef and use vegetable broth instead of beef broth. You’ll still get a rich, hearty soup thanks to the beans and tomatoes.

What type of pasta works best?

Ditalini is the traditional choice, but small shells, elbow macaroni, or even orzo work just as well.

Can I use canned beans instead of dried beans?

Yes. This recipe is designed for canned beans, making it quick and easy. If using dried beans, soak them overnight and cook them separately before adding them to the crockpot.

Can I make this on the stovetop instead?

Yes. Sauté the beef and vegetables in a large pot, then add the remaining ingredients (except pasta) and simmer for about 30-40 minutes. Add the pasta in the last 10 minutes of cooking.

How can I make this soup thicker?

Mash some of the beans before adding them to the crockpot, or stir in a tablespoon of tomato paste to give the broth a heartier consistency.

Is this recipe spicy?

No, but you can easily add some heat. Sprinkle in red pepper flakes or stir in a bit of hot sauce before serving.

Variations & Customizations

This recipe is incredibly versatile. Here are some ways to make it your own:

Make It Creamy

  • Stir in a splash of heavy cream at the end for a creamier texture.
  • Add a Parmesan rind while it cooks for extra richness.

Add More Protein

  • Swap ground beef for Italian sausage, turkey, or shredded chicken.
  • Stir in cooked, crumbled bacon before serving for a smoky flavor.

Boost the Vegetables

  • Add spinach or kale during the last 10 minutes of cooking.
  • Stir in zucchini or bell peppers for extra nutrients.

Go Low-Carb

  • Skip the pasta and replace it with cauliflower rice or zucchini noodles.

Related Recipes to Try Next

If you loved this Crockpot Pasta Fagioli, you might enjoy these other comforting dishes:

Final Thoughts

Crockpot Pasta Fagioli is the perfect balance of simplicity and deep, satisfying flavor. It’s a recipe you’ll want to make again and again, whether for an easy weeknight dinner or a cozy weekend meal.

If you give this recipe a try, let us know how it turned out. Share your thoughts, any tweaks you made, or your favorite way to serve it. And if you’re planning to make a big batch, don’t forget to freeze some for later—you’ll be glad you did.

Print
cl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on
A bowl of Crockpot Pasta Fagioli with ground beef, beans, and pasta in a rich tomato broth, garnished with Parmesan and fresh parsley.

Crockpot Pasta Fagioli Recipe


  • Author: Ava
  • Total Time: 6-8 hours 15 minutes
  • Yield: 6-8 servings 1x

Description

This Crockpot Pasta Fagioli is a comforting and hearty Italian soup loaded with ground beef, beans, pasta, and rich tomato broth. With minimal prep and a slow cooker doing all the work, this dish is perfect for meal prep or a cozy family dinner. Serve it with crusty bread and Parmesan for an authentic Italian touch.


Ingredients

Scale
  • 1 lb ground beef
  • 1 small onion, diced
  • 3 cloves garlic, minced
  • 3 carrots, diced
  • 3 celery stalks, diced
  • 1 (15 oz) can diced tomatoes
  • 1 (15 oz) can tomato sauce
  • 1 (15 oz) can red kidney beans, drained and rinsed
  • 1 (15 oz) can great northern beans, drained and rinsed
  • 4 cups beef broth
  • 1 tsp Italian seasoning
  • 1 tsp salt (or to taste)
  • 1/2 tsp black pepper
  • 1/2 tsp dried oregano
  • 1/2 tsp dried basil
  • 1 cup ditalini pasta
  • 1/2 cup grated Parmesan cheese (for serving)
  • 2 tbsp fresh parsley, chopped (for garnish)

Instructions

  • Brown the beef – Cook ground beef in a skillet over medium heat until browned. Drain excess fat and transfer to the slow cooker.
  • Add vegetables & seasonings – Mix in onion, garlic, carrots, celery, diced tomatoes, tomato sauce, beans, beef broth, and seasonings. Stir to combine.
  • Slow cook – Cover and cook on low for 6-8 hours or high for 3-4 hours until vegetables are tender.
  • Cook the pasta – About 30 minutes before serving, add the ditalini pasta and stir. Cover and cook until pasta is tender.
  • Serve & garnish – Ladle into bowls, sprinkle with Parmesan cheese, and garnish with fresh parsley. Serve warm.

Notes

  • For a vegetarian version, substitute vegetable broth and omit the meat.
  • To freeze, store without the pasta and add fresh pasta when reheating.
  • Make it spicier by adding red pepper flakes.
  • Prep Time: 15 minutes
  • Cook Time: 6-8 hours (low) / 3-4 hours (high)
  • Category: Soup
  • Method: Slow Cooker
  • Cuisine: Italian

Nutrition

  • Calories: ~320
  • Sodium: 870mg
  • Fat: 8g
  • Carbohydrates: 45g
  • Fiber: 8g
  • Protein: 25g

Keywords: Slow Cooker Pasta Fagioli, Pasta e Fagioli Soup, Italian Bean Soup, Hearty Slow Cooker Soup

Leave a Comment

Recipe rating